Latest revision as of 11:29, 31 October 2019

In the following example we have used a csv file separated by comma,but there is also the option to import a csv file separated by semicolon.

  • In order to be successful the importation of the Alias you have to create a csv file similar to the following picture:
  1. Press import button.
  2. Select your preferences and the file
  3. Press Import
